[* black] We already took apart the iPad during [guide|5071|the teardown], so here's a peek of all the fun stuff from the inside... | |
[* red] The sleep sensor. This is the little sensor that reacts to the Smart Cover's round magnet for turning on/off the iPad 2's screen. | |
[* yellow] This row of magnets clamps the Smart Cover tightly to the iPad 2 (on the right side). Note that the magnets have their polarity displayed, and that they alternate in polarity: + - + - . | |
- | [* black] The alternating polarity of the magnets in the iPad 2 is complemented by the alternating polarity of the magnets in the Smart Cover, ensuring that the Smart Cover always sits in the same orientation. |
